POST Api/Vendor/AddVendorFileData

Request Information

URI Parameters

None.

Body Parameters

UploadVendorDataRequest
NameDescriptionTypeAdditional information
UploadType

UploadType

None.

VendorData

Collection of VendorsExcel

None.

Request Formats

application/json, text/json

Sample:
{
  "UploadType": 0,
  "VendorData": [
    {
      "VendorNumber": "sample string 1",
      "CompanyName": "sample string 2",
      "PrimaryContactName": "sample string 3",
      "PrimaryContactPhone": "sample string 4",
      "PrimaryContactEmail": "sample string 5",
      "VendorAddress": "sample string 6",
      "IsActive": true,
      "Notes": "sample string 8",
      "Row": 9
    },
    {
      "VendorNumber": "sample string 1",
      "CompanyName": "sample string 2",
      "PrimaryContactName": "sample string 3",
      "PrimaryContactPhone": "sample string 4",
      "PrimaryContactEmail": "sample string 5",
      "VendorAddress": "sample string 6",
      "IsActive": true,
      "Notes": "sample string 8",
      "Row": 9
    }
  ]
}

application/xml, text/xml

Sample:
<UploadVendorDataRequest xmlns:i="http://www.w3.org/2001/XMLSchema-instance" xmlns="http://schemas.datacontract.org/2004/07/Qorus.TasQ.ClassModels.NAServices.Request">
  <UploadType>AppendInExisting</UploadType>
  <VendorData xmlns:d2p1="http://schemas.datacontract.org/2004/07/Qorus.TasQ.ClassModels.ExcelImportModels.NAServices">
    <d2p1:VendorsExcel>
      <Row xmlns="http://schemas.datacontract.org/2004/07/Qorus.TasQ.ClassModels.ExcelImportModels">9</Row>
      <d2p1:CompanyName>sample string 2</d2p1:CompanyName>
      <d2p1:IsActive>true</d2p1:IsActive>
      <d2p1:Notes>sample string 8</d2p1:Notes>
      <d2p1:PrimaryContactEmail>sample string 5</d2p1:PrimaryContactEmail>
      <d2p1:PrimaryContactName>sample string 3</d2p1:PrimaryContactName>
      <d2p1:PrimaryContactPhone>sample string 4</d2p1:PrimaryContactPhone>
      <d2p1:VendorAddress>sample string 6</d2p1:VendorAddress>
      <d2p1:VendorNumber>sample string 1</d2p1:VendorNumber>
    </d2p1:VendorsExcel>
    <d2p1:VendorsExcel>
      <Row xmlns="http://schemas.datacontract.org/2004/07/Qorus.TasQ.ClassModels.ExcelImportModels">9</Row>
      <d2p1:CompanyName>sample string 2</d2p1:CompanyName>
      <d2p1:IsActive>true</d2p1:IsActive>
      <d2p1:Notes>sample string 8</d2p1:Notes>
      <d2p1:PrimaryContactEmail>sample string 5</d2p1:PrimaryContactEmail>
      <d2p1:PrimaryContactName>sample string 3</d2p1:PrimaryContactName>
      <d2p1:PrimaryContactPhone>sample string 4</d2p1:PrimaryContactPhone>
      <d2p1:VendorAddress>sample string 6</d2p1:VendorAddress>
      <d2p1:VendorNumber>sample string 1</d2p1:VendorNumber>
    </d2p1:VendorsExcel>
  </VendorData>
</UploadVendorDataRequest>

application/x-www-form-urlencoded

Sample:

Sample not available.

Response Information

Resource Description

IHttpActionResult

None.

Response Formats

application/json, text/json, application/xml, text/xml

Sample:

Sample not available.